This vivid anthology showcases the evolution of cyberpunk, welcoming a new generation of writers who push the genre into innovative territories. With a punk rock spirit, cyberpunk navigates the realms of the internet, bioengineering, and global politics, leaving a significant mark on entertainment and media. Drawing inspiration from the pioneering manifesto, Mirrorshades, each story explores the gritty realities of technological transformation. The collection features contributions from legendary editor Bruce Sterling alongside contemporary authors such as Cory Doctorow, Jonathan Lethem, Gwyneth Jones, Hal Duncan, Charles Stross, and Pat Cadigan. An engaging introduction by James Patrick Kelly and John Kessel sets the stage for this exhilarating snapshot of a dynamic literary movement. The anthology includes stories like “Bicycle Repairman” by Sterling, “Lobsters” by Stross, and “When Sysadmins Ruled the Earth” by Doctorow, among others. Each piece reflects the genre's essence, offering diverse perspectives on the future shaped by technology. This collection is a testament to the enduring and evolving spirit of cyberpunk literature.
